Microsoft and the Internet of Things : from the "things" to the "cloud"

Few days ago Microsoft was included in the ranking of the 10 most innovative companies of 2015 as part of the Internet of Things and this result can not be absolutely considered a case. Most likely, the main reasons that have enabled Microsoft to achieve this great result are two : The announcement of an operating system like Windows 10 that is able to run on any kind of device, from embedded systems, smartphones, tablets, gaming consoles and finally to the PC; The wide Microsoft Azure cloud services offer through which you can "accommodate" and analyze in real time the huge amount of data from the "things"; The Microsoft offer for the Internet of Things covers everything from embedded device (the "T") to the Cloud (the "I") failing to provide a solution under one "hat".   What are the available technologies ? How can we really "bring" our "things" in the Cloud and make them an integral part of the Internet of "Your" Things as it was renamed by Microsoft ...

Part-3: Download and Debug Compact 2013 OS Runtime Image

As part of any sizable software development project, the need to perform repetitive testing and debugging tasks is a common routine.  As part of a project to develop custom OS runtime image for a target device, deploying OS runtime image onto the target device for testing and debugging is one of the repetitive tasks.  Without the tool to download the OS runtime image to the target device, it’s tedious and time consuming to have to manually transfer the image onto the device for each test and debug session.


Compact 2013 provides an efficient development environment that enables you to download OS runtime image, generated from the OS design project, directly from the Visual Studio IDE to the target device for testing and debugging.  In addition, the Compact 2013 development environment also provide a suite of tools to remotely debug the OS runtime image as the image execute on the device.

Part-2: Compact 2013 OS Design Development

Whether you are working with Linux, Windows or other RTOS, develop custom OS runtime image for a targeted hardware platform, without help from efficient development tool, is a daunting, tedious and time consuming task.  To help simplify the complexity in developing custom Compact 2013 OS runtime image, Microsoft provides the Platform Builder suite of tools, a set of free plug-in for the Visual Studio 2012 and 2013 IDE, available for download from Microsoft website.

In part-2 of this Compact 2013 getting started series, we will work through the steps, using the Platform Builder plug-in for Visual Studio 2013, to develop an OS design project and generate an OS runtime image for a target device.

A new home for the .Net Micro Framework … GitHub !!

The first "visible" step of the new .Net Micro Framework has been accomplished ... finally the official repository for the future versions is GitHub; viceversa all previous versions of the framework will remain onCodePlex as the forum. Each bug/issue reported on CodePlex will be evaluated and included as "work item" on GitHub.

 

Due to the "interpreter" nature of the runtime, the project was named ".Net Micro Framework Interpreter" but contains the interpreter, the BCL (Base Class Library) and the native code for porting.
